NM MILITARY LEGACY PROJECT The New Mexico Military Legacy Project was created by New Mexico Department of Veterans’ Services (NMDVS) Cabinet Secretary John M. Garcia to preserve the state’s rich military tradition. New Mexico consistently ranks among the top states nationwide in percentage of a state’s population which serve in the military. The NMDVS has contracted with independent movie production companies to produce documentary movies showing this outstanding commitment to military service…and the sacrifice which New Mexicans have historically made when serving our country in times of war. But these documentaries are more than just movies. They’re an educational tool which future generations can learn about what their ancestors have endured in order to preserve our freedom as American citizens.
